Highlanders top Hill in game one, game two suspended
The McLennan Highlanders and Hill Rebels met at Bosque River Ballpark Saturday afternoon for the final two games of their four-game conference series. The Highlanders got a victory in game one but game two was suspended due to darkness with Hill leading 16-9 after eight innings.
The Highlanders defeated the Rebels 8-2 in the opener with Jase Embry getting the win on the mound.
McLennan began the scoring with one run in the bottom of the first inning as Dylan Neuse singled, moved to second on a balk and scored on a single by Keaton Milford.
The Highlanders added two runs in the second. Thomas Santos led off with a single but was out at second on a fielder's choice by Nick Thornquist. George Callil followed with a triple to score Thornquist; and Callil scored on a triple by Neuse.
Three more Highlander runs scored in the bottom of the third. Josh Breaux drew a walk, moved to second on a wild pitch and scored on a double by Griffin Paxton. Santos followed with a single and both runners scored on a triple by Thornquist.
The final two McLennan runs scored in the fifth. Santos was safe at first on an error and Thornquist singled. Both runners scored on a single by Callil.
The win secures the series win for the Highlanders and improves their conference record to 3-0 and overall record to 16-5.
